 Why Earnest Money Deposit Requirements Can Be High

Tawnya Gilreath a Los Angeles area business broker explains why earnest money deposits serve two purposes. First, they show the Seller that you are serious about buying the business. Secondly, in the event that you as the Buyer default on the purchase agreement after due diligence and other contingencies have been removed, the earnest money deposit typically serves as liquidated damages to the seller.
